[pdf] In 2024, Costa Rica's sales of new all-electric passenger vehicles surged to a record 11,373 units, marking an 80% increase from the previous year. Another way of looking at this is that more BEVs were sold in 2024 than in all years prior. 4%. . For the third consecutive year, this small but mighty Central American nation has achieved the highest market share of all-electric vehicles in the region, a remarkable feat that underscores its dedication to sustainable transportation solutions. [pdf] Unlike small-scale test programs, this research analyzed wireless driving data from approximately one million PHEVs produced between 2021 and 2023. That makes it one of the most comprehensive real-world evaluations of plug-in hybrid efficiency to date. . Plug-in hybrid vehicles are often touted as a bridge to battery-electric vehicles, promising to slash emissions by operating as EVs for short trips while relying on fossil fuels for longer ones. They only deliver on that promise if they're regularly charged. PHEVs use both gasoline and electricity as fuel sources. We will get into the. . A comprehensive study by Germany's Fraunhofer Institute found that many PHEVs consume significantly more fuel in everyday driving than their official lab ratings suggest — in some cases, up to three times more.
